Most divorcing couples trying to agree a financial settlement on divorce want to avoid a court process, as this this can be an expensive, acrimonious and protracted process. However, people can feel out of their depth trying to negotiate a settlement for one or more of a number of reasons, for example:

  • They are unlikely to be fully conversant with the rules for distributing assets and pensions or for determining whether spousal maintenance is necessary. These are not black and white; there are many grey areas. 
  • One person may have far more knowledge and understanding of the assets than the other and this can create a power imbalance, leaving the other feeling exposed and vulnerable.
  • Their respective perceptions of fairness may differ considerably through the lens of a relationship breakdown, in which emotions often run high.
  • Their finances may not be straight forward and they require the assistance of experts to understand the value of assets such as private companies, trust interests, complex income structures and the potential tax implications of a financial settlement.

Specialist Family Solicitors

Instructing a solicitor to guide you through this process does not mean that you intend to go to court. Much of our work as family lawyers involves solicitor-led negotiations with a view to reaching a settlement on behalf of our clients without requiring a court timetable to reach a resolution. These can take several forms:

  • Round table meetings on a “without prejudice” basis to narrow the issues and explore proposals for settlement
  • Negotiations through solicitors’ correspondence
  • Supporting and advising clients through a non-court dispute resolution process, such as Early Neutral Evaluation or mediation.
